i went bowling today with japanese people. one man, Masa, and three women: Chiaki, Kikomo, and i cant remember the other one. but i signed up earlier to participate in a cultural thing that was that. i won and i got a prize but it was shoe cleaner and a shoe horn which was a nice gesture. i guess this is where the saying "its the thought that counts" comes into play. my team got 4th place and won a big Asahi gift set. for those that dont know what asahi is, its beer. after that i walked around trying to find a place called unko which served Okonomiyaki and i asked a mother and her ddaughter and they walked me the whole way. it was about 2 blocks. that is how hospitable they are. She showed me the place and i went in and sat down. they put lettuce, squid, crab, and prawn in it along with an egg to make it grill, and then gave me a small glass of barley tea, which was disgustiing ut i didnt want to offend them so i muscled it down then they got me another one. so i grabbed a pepsi and drank that most of the time. the tea cleaned out my system though. then i went to a department store in ginza that was 8 floors high and visited every floor talking to random people including salesclerks and normal people trying to see who would help. they all helped. so i got what i wanted. i used more japanese today than ever.
the people i played bowling with all wanted my information like cell phone number and email address so i traded info with all of them.

today, i started off by getting a shot for typhoid which made me drowsy so after lunch i fell asleep for a good 2 hrs. soon after that i went to ginza (a big strip of shops and restaurants) and walked around gazing at all of the beautiful japanese women in short skirts and long boots, its a males fantasy. i went to eat at a place called gyuemon's. i got some steak pieces in some sauce. it was good. i went to a couple shops and looked around but didnt buy anthing until i went to a department mall that had a regular store on the second and third floor and a food market on the first floor. decided to buy some little things there including some little balls of honey bread that dissolve when you eat them, kakinotane which is rice crackers and peanuts that are a bit spicy, Pocky which are biscuit sticks dipped in chocolate and strawberry and other flavors. i went to find something i had last time i came to japan called Inarizushi which is not sushi, it is like rice wrapped in fried tofu. its hard to say what it is because i cant read the packaging. i couldnt find it so i employed the services of some japanese schoolgirls which were probably 15 or 16. you can tell by the length and color of their socks, the longer they are they older in school they are. they found where they would be but they were out. for a minute i thought they were running away from me, but they were going to find out. after that i went to a club that plays music. the owners son has a band and his band does cover songs of red hot chili peppers, oasis, nirvana, sublime and they did the song "Foxxy Lady", i dont know who sings it, but they did really well. they are really talented. they played a bunch of songs and then when they were nearly finished they introduced the members of the band and that member would play for a little bit, then the lead guitarist/singer and support guitarist/ backup vocals had a guitar battle in which they ended together playing the mario song, and then they played one more song. i left after that and had the chance to talk with "jackson" dont know his real name, in the elevator. i would give them an 8 out of 10 because some of the words they didnt get correctly in the songs. i went back to the ship after picking up some sheets and a pillow. and now i am typing this. i will try and update as much as possible, i just dont know how much internet access i will get when we are underway or how much free time.
